This is written on the plaque:
Eliane Cossey (Poperinge 1902-London 1942)
To countless soldiers from all corners of the British Empire, she was known as Ginger for her bright red hair and cheerful vivacity.
She embodied for many a reminder of human dignity and life, that they carried into the hell of the trenches, as a spark in their hearts.
Artist: Nele Boudry 2015
